Responsibilities
 
  • Prepare and distribute monthly financial statements and operational reports for leadership, board, and parent company
  • Own accounts payable and receivable - monitor balances, coordinate vendor payments, and ensure timely collections
  • Maintain the general ledger and support month-end close in coordination with leadership and external accountants
  • Track project-level financials; ensure labor charges and expenses are accurately recorded against contract charge codes
  • Reconcile company expenses through Ramp; maintain organized documentation for all transactions
  • Manage purchase orders and procurement - track orders, manage vendors, and maintain records
  • Collect and submit weekly timecards for staff and contractors; ensure accuracy against charge codes
  • Book and coordinate company travel; track expenses against government per diem rates where applicable
  • Support new hire onboarding logistics and own executive calendaring across the leadership team
  • Maintain organized filing systems across Google Workspace for contracts, HR, and financial records
  • Assist with board materials, leadership meeting prep, and ad hoc projects as directed by the CEO
